Pete Davidson is so in the fiancee Ariana Grande, but he needs a bit of space from some pop star fans.

The comedian "Saturday Night Live" abruptly erased his Instagram account Monday, removing all traces of Grande and his social media footprint following a series of spas on the internet.

After getting gloomy on Instagram, Davidson assured his more than 2 million followers that everything was fine, with the exception of "negative energy" that appeared on the networks social.

"No, there is nothing wrong with it, nothing happened, no, there is nothing cryptic about anything", a- he explained on Instagram Stories. "I do not want to be on Instagram anymore. Or on any social media platform. The Internet is an evil place and it does not do me any good. Why should I spend time on negative energy when my real life is on? The fact that I even have to say that proves my point. I love you all and I'm sure I'll be back at some point.

It's not clear exactly what Davidson's tipping point is, but he had a heated exchange with a fan who ridiculed his comment on a photo. de Grande and her late grandfather as insensitive.

The comedian wrote next to a black and white photo of both: "omg what cute", which for some reason attracted the enemies.

"Are you all crazy?" Davidson wrote in response to a review. "I was talking about how cute his grandfather is.What's wrong with that?" "You're really going to look for anything to attack people." It's sad. "

Davidson's current antisocial stance has apparently rubbed off on Grande, who announced that she was also taking a step back from Twitter and Instagram.

"Sometimes I can not help falling on a negative shit that can really do damage and it's not worth it," she wrote on Monday.
